2005 GMC Sierra vs. 2011 Mitsubishi Pajero
To start off, 2011 Mitsubishi Pajero is newer by 6 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 2005 GMC Sierra.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 2005 GMC Sierra would be higher. At 5,358 cc (8 cylinders), 2005 GMC Sierra is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2005 GMC Sierra (295 HP) has 132 more horse power than 2011 Mitsubishi Pajero. (163 HP). In normal driving conditions, 2005 GMC Sierra should accelerate faster than 2011 Mitsubishi Pajero.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2005 GMC Sierra weights approximately 723 kg more than 2011 Mitsubishi Pajero.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.
Because 2011 Mitsubishi Pajero is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 2005 GMC Sierra.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2011 Mitsubishi Pajero will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2005 GMC Sierra (454 Nm) has 81 more torque (in Nm) than 2011 Mitsubishi Pajero. (373 Nm). This means 2005 GMC Sierra will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2011 Mitsubishi Pajero. 2011 Mitsubishi Pajero has automatic transmission and 2005 GMC Sierra has manual transmission. 2005 GMC Sierra will offer better control over acceleration and deceleration in addition to better fuel efficiency overall. 2011 Mitsubishi Pajero will be easier to drive especially in heavy traffic.
Compare all specifications:
2005 GMC Sierra | 2011 Mitsubishi Pajero | |
Make | GMC | Mitsubishi |
Model | Sierra | Pajero |
Year Released | 2005 | 2011 |
Body Type | Pickup | SUV |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 5358 cc | 3199 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 8 cylinders | 4 cylinders |
Engine Type | V | in-line |
Valves per Cylinder | 2 valves | 4 valves |
Horse Power | 295 HP | 163 HP |
Torque | 454 Nm | 373 Nm |
Engine Bore Size | 96 mm | 98.5 mm |
Engine Stroke Size | 92 mm | 105 mm |
Engine Compression Ratio | 9.5:1 | 17.0:1 |
Drive Type | Rear | 4WD |
Transmission Type | Manual | Automatic |
Number of Seats | 6 seats | 7 seats |
Number of Doors | 4 doors | 5 doors |
Vehicle Weight | 2263 kg | 1540 kg |
Vehicle Length | 5850 mm | 4910 mm |
Vehicle Width | 2000 mm | 1910 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1850 mm | 1880 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 3650 mm | 2790 mm |
Fuel Consumption Overall | 13.1 L/100km | 10.2 L/100km |
Fuel Tank Capacity | 98 L | 88 L |
